Bacon-Wrapped Pork Medallions with Garlic-Mustard Butter image

What You’ll Need

1 Prairie Fresh® pork tenderloin (1 lb. to 1 1/4 lb.)
4 slices Daily's® bacon

Wooden picks
Salt and pepper

Garlic-Mustard Butter
1/4 cup butter
2 teaspoons of Dijon mustard 
1 clove garlic, minced

Directions

Cut tenderloin in 8 slices (medallions) approximately 1 to 1 1/4 inch wide. Place two slices (medallions) together and wrap bacon slice around both pieces to hold together to make pork "mignons." Secure with wooden pick. Repeat with remaining pork medallions and bacon. 

Season both sides with salt and pepper and spray lightly with cooking spray. Broil or grill to 160ºF internal temperature. 

Remove wooden pick; serve with Garlic-Mustard Butter. 

GARLIC-MUSTARD BUTTER
In a small bowl, stir butter, Dijon mustard and garlic. Combine thoroughly. (Can be prepared up to 2 days prior, refrigerated.)
